Liveness probe: per-draw polygon-site counts for any capture
probe_live.py boots a capture (with the required r.start()) and counts per-draw hits at the known polygon sites (quadA/triB/emit-header/VSTRIP). Discriminates real scene content from the background-only test bench. Findings so far: every cap* capture + ravtest + dtest + sharksval = the SAME hardware test bench (one 9x5 patch; sharksval draws it 3x); real content lives in the extra-action captures (sdemo/glblade/munga/trek/fxtest/klng*), which DO replay (fxtest ran 6K+ commands incl. act25/42 with no faults) but have much larger scene builds.
